关于NDB的最新信息

Hideo Yasunaga1

  • 1Department of Clinical Epidemiology and Health Economics, School of Public Health, The University of Tokyo.

Annals of clinical epidemiology
|July 22, 2024
PubMed
概括
此摘要是机器生成的。

日本国家医疗保险索赔和特定健康检查数据库 (NDB) 正在扩大其数据可访问性和链接性. 最近的研究显示,越来越多地使用NDB数据,强调其在健康研究中的重要性日益增加.

科学领域:

  • 医疗保健服务研究 医疗服务研究
  • 公共卫生 公共卫生
  • 医疗信息学 医疗信息学

背景情况:

  • 日本国家医疗保险索赔和特定健康检查数据库 (NDB) 成立于2009年.
  • 此前关于NDB的信息是在2019年发布的.
  • 2020年,向各个部门提供数据的立法已在2020年立法.

研究的目的:

  • 提供关于新兴人民银行的最新信息.
  • 审查使用NDB数据的最新文献.
  • 评估NDB研究的当前趋势和未来潜力.

主要方法:

  • 使用NDB和NDB开放数据的原始文章的文献综述.
  • 从2013年到现在的出版趋势分析.
  • 计划与其他国家数据库的NDB数据链接的描述.

主要成果:

  • 在之前的审查中,从2013年到2022年期间,确定了126篇文章.
  • 一项最新的审查发现,在最近两年中,有94篇文章.
  • 使用NDB数据的研究数量正在稳步增加.

结论:

  • 新开发银行是日益被利用的日本卫生研究资源.
  • 在各种学科领域扩大NDB研究的潜力很大.
  • 预计计划中的数据链接将进一步增强研究能力.
